I also did a different gradient technique, now the last time I tried this technique it failed. But that was my fault, I was a bit too cack-handed. Normally I get the sponge and do one colour at a time, I knew the paint all the colours on the sponge and press on would make my gradients look better but I fail to use good advice.
My gradient is blended, when I look close up, the parts where the pink goes into orange and orange goes into green and the blend is beautiful and I am proud. Usually that blend is not there. That's the case for my thumb and ring finger cause I was lazy haha, but I still like those gradients.

Neon polishes:
Pink: Nails Inc - Notting Hill Gate
Orange: Models Own - Beach Party
Green: China Glaze - I'm With The Lifeguard
I really like the colour of this but it's SO sheer, so many coats were done that day.
White base: Barry M - Matt White
Black and white glitter: L'Oreal Color Riche - Confetti
Regular polishes:
Pink: No7 - Me! Me! Me!
Orange: Essie - Tart Deco
Green: OPI - Jade Is The New Black
Rainbow glitter: OPI - Rainbow Connection
